Transaction d6ecf981d868e3e04e44245301106de4e17e4e04e67a08e1c2772d4d0d93ff64
1 Input
1 Output
-
d6ecf981d868e3e04e44245301106de4e17e4e04e67a08e1c2772d4d0d93ff64:0
- value
- 4170751
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4142b01984096fd744b413119d04da40cd54e1e
- address
- bc1qus2zkqvcgzt06aztgyc3n5zd5sxd2ns75c8a35